Section 38
of Competition Commission Act 2010
Section 38
The Commission may appoint such number of Commission officers as it considers necessary to exercise the powers provided under the competition laws.
(2)
For purposes of an investigation under the competition laws, the Commission may appoint its employee or any other person to be a Commission officer.

(3)
A Commission officer who is not an employee of the
Commission shall be subject to obligations of secrecy under section 43, and shall enjoy protection and indemnity as may be specified in this Act or other written law applicable to an employee of the
Commission, as the case may be.
(4)
A Commission officer shall have all the powers necessary to carry out inspection and investigation of any offence or infringement under the competition laws.
